What Are the Key Types of Golf Betting Available?
The key types of golf betting available include various formats that cater to different preferences and strategies of bettors.
- Match Betting: This involves betting on the outcome of a match between two players, where the bettor simply picks which player will perform better. It is popular because it focuses on head-to-head performance rather than the overall tournament outcome, allowing for more strategic betting based on player form and course conditions.
- Outright Winner Betting: Bettors place wagers on who they believe will win the entire tournament. This type of bet often offers higher odds for less favored players, making it attractive for those looking for larger payouts, but it requires a good understanding of player performance over multiple rounds.
- Top 5/10 Finish Betting: This bet allows players to wager on whether a golfer will finish within the top 5 or top 10 of the tournament. It offers a safer option compared to outright betting, as it increases the chance of winning while still providing decent odds, especially for consistent performers.
- Prop Bets: These are proposition bets that focus on specific outcomes within a tournament, such as the number of birdies a player will make or whether a golfer will hit a hole-in-one. Prop bets can be highly entertaining and provide unique opportunities for bettors to engage with the events beyond just the final score.
- Live Betting: This type of betting occurs during the tournament, allowing bettors to place wagers as the action unfolds. Live betting can be advantageous because it gives bettors the opportunity to assess player performance and course conditions in real-time, adjusting their bets based on the ongoing events.
How Does Head-to-Head Betting Work in Golf?
- Selection of Players: In head-to-head betting, sportsbooks will offer matchups between two golfers, typically based on their current form, ranking, and performance history.
- Betting Odds: Each player will have associated odds reflecting their chances of winning the matchup, with the better-performing player often having lower odds, indicating a higher probability of winning.
- Wagering Process: Bettors choose which of the two players they believe will perform better over the course of the tournament, and their stake is placed accordingly.
- Settlement of Bets: The bet is settled based on the players’ final scores; the golfer with the lower score wins the head-to-head match, and bettors receive their payout based on the odds at the time of the wager.
Selection of Players: The selection of players is crucial, as it determines the matchup for the bet. Sportsbooks analyze various factors, including recent performances, course history, and player fitness, to create competitive pairings that reflect the golfers’ abilities.
Betting Odds: Odds are a key component of head-to-head betting, serving as a reflection of each player’s likelihood of winning the matchup. Lower odds indicate a favorite, while higher odds suggest an underdog, allowing bettors to assess potential returns based on their risk appetite.
Wagering Process: Bettors can place their wagers online or at physical sportsbooks, typically selecting a stake amount that reflects their confidence in the chosen player. This straightforward format allows for strategic betting based on personal insights or statistical analysis.
Settlement of Bets: After the tournament concludes, the results determine the outcome of the head-to-head bet. If the selected golfer has the lower score compared to the opponent, the bettor wins, and the payout is calculated based on the odds; if not, the stake is lost.
What Is the Nature of Match Play Betting in Golf?
Key aspects of match play betting include the understanding of player form, course conditions, and head-to-head statistics. Bettors often analyze how players perform on specific courses, their historical matchups against their opponents, and current form to make informed betting decisions. For example, a player known for strong performances under pressure may have an edge in match play, where the stakes are high and each hole can shift momentum significantly.
This betting format impacts both casual and serious golf fans, as it adds an element of excitement and strategy to the viewing experience. Match play allows for more dynamic betting opportunities, such as live betting during the match, which can enhance engagement as players make strategic decisions hole by hole. Moreover, the head-to-head nature can lead to more predictable outcomes based on player matchups, which may provide bettors with a tactical advantage.
Statistics indicate that match play events can be highly unpredictable, with upsets occurring frequently. For instance, the 2019 WGC-Dell Match Play saw several lower-ranked players defeating top-ranked opponents, illustrating the volatility and excitement inherent in this format. This unpredictability can be beneficial for savvy bettors who can identify value bets based on player performance trends.
To maximize success in match play betting, best practices include thorough research into player stats, understanding the dynamics of match play as it differs from stroke play, and keeping an eye on factors such as weather conditions and course layout. Bettors are also advised to consider how each player’s style matches up against their opponent, as certain players may thrive in match play scenarios while others struggle. By employing these strategies, bettors can make more informed decisions and potentially increase their chances of winning in the exciting realm of match play golf betting.

In What Ways Can Weather Affect Your Golf Betting Strategy?
Weather can significantly influence your golf betting strategy in several ways:
- Wind Conditions: Wind can affect the trajectory and distance of shots, making it crucial to consider when placing bets. Players who are adept at dealing with strong winds often perform better in these conditions, so analyzing their past performances can provide insight into potential outcomes.
- Rain and Wet Conditions: Wet courses can lead to softer greens and fairways, impacting how the ball behaves upon landing. Players who excel in wet conditions may have an advantage, as they can better manage the challenges of reduced roll and altered course dynamics.
- Temperature: Temperature influences how golf balls travel, with warmer air allowing for greater distance. Understanding how temperature affects specific players can help in assessing their performance; some players thrive in hot conditions while others may struggle.
- Humidity: High humidity can affect both player performance and ball behavior. Moist air can lead to denser conditions that may change how far balls travel, and players who are accustomed to playing in humid climates could have an edge over those who are not.
- Course Conditions: Overall weather conditions lead to varying course conditions, such as how firm or soft the greens are. Courses that are baked hard due to dry weather can favor long hitters, while softer conditions may benefit those with a more precise short game.
How Do Course Conditions Impact Golf Betting Success?
- Weather Conditions: Weather can drastically affect a course’s playability, impacting player scores and strategies. Factors such as wind, rain, and temperature can change how players approach each hole, making it crucial for bettors to consider these elements when placing wagers.
- Course Layout: The design and layout of a golf course can favor certain types of players based on their strengths and weaknesses. For example, courses with narrow fairways might benefit accurate drivers, while those with more water hazards could favor players with exceptional short games.
- Grass Type: Different courses use various grass types, which can affect ball speed and player comfort. For instance, players who are accustomed to putting on Bermuda grass may struggle on a course with bentgrass greens, thereby influencing their performance and the betting odds.
- Course Length: The length of the course can dictate the strategies players utilize, with longer courses typically favoring longer hitters. Bettors should analyze a player’s driving distance in relation to the course length to gauge potential success accurately.
- Current Course Conditions: Conditions such as moisture levels, rough height, and green speed can fluctuate even during a tournament. Keeping abreast of these factors helps bettors make informed decisions as they can significantly impact scoring averages and player performance throughout the event.

How Can You Utilize Bankroll Management for Golf Bets?
Effective bankroll management is crucial for successful golf betting, ensuring that bettors can enjoy the game while minimizing risks.
- Set a Budget: Determine how much money you can afford to lose without impacting your financial stability.
- Use a Percentage of Your Bankroll: Bet a small percentage of your total bankroll on each wager to mitigate risks.
- Track Your Bets: Keep a detailed record of all your bets to analyze performance and adjust strategies accordingly.
- Adjust Your Stakes: Reassess your bet sizes based on your current bankroll and previous betting performance.
- Stay Disciplined: Stick to your established bankroll management strategy without succumbing to emotional betting.
Set a Budget: Establishing a clear budget is the first step in bankroll management. This budget should be an amount that you are comfortable risking, ensuring it won’t affect your everyday expenses or financial obligations.
Use a Percentage of Your Bankroll: A common strategy is to wager a small percentage—typically between 1% to 5%—of your total bankroll on each bet. This method helps to spread your risk and allows you to stay in the game longer, even if you experience losses.
Track Your Bets: Maintaining a record of your betting activities helps you evaluate your success and identify patterns in your betting behavior. By analyzing your wins and losses, you can refine your strategy and make more informed decisions in the future.
Adjust Your Stakes: Regularly review your bankroll and adjust your betting stakes accordingly. If your bankroll increases due to successful bets, you may choose to raise your stakes, whereas, in the case of losses, it’s wise to lower your stakes to preserve your remaining funds.
Stay Disciplined: Emotional betting can lead to poor decisions, so it’s essential to stick to your bankroll management plan. By remaining disciplined and not chasing losses, you are more likely to achieve long-term success in golf betting.
